The music may have stopped, and the balloons are no longer floating above the tables, but the connections that have been re-kindled after 50 plus years are still going strong. Some of us feel a little melancholy as the festivities recede into the back ground of every day life. It is difficult to believe it has been 50 years since our high school graduation. The reunion week end started with the home coming parade, at the high school. Despite the drizzle our former Drum Majorette, Arlene Rodriguez Harriman led the parade of classmates carrying our reunion banner across the football field. After that we shared memories at the Elk's Club with a pizza party, where we displayed a Memory Board and pictures of many of our homes from our high school years. Saturday morning a big group started with the tour of the high school, walking the hallowed halls of our youth. The afternoon picnic attended by almost 200, was fun with a few of our classmates bringing antique cars to display. Saturday evening we hosted a table of several former teachers, at cocktails, dinner and dancing at the Embassy Suites. There were over 287 attendees enjoying the evening. Sunday many of us lingered over brunch, reluctant to let go of the memories and time shared with old friends and making new friends. There were many unfinished conversations and shared memories yet to be explored. We will be sending a Memory Book to recapture some of the week end, it will include a directory so we can keep the connections going. Looking forward to seeing everyone at the 55th reunion, if not before! Carol Swagler Christensen |
